Windows Registry Settings

This document is provided as a reference to the Windows registry settings implemented by Communicator and Navigator. You may use this as a guide to the registry settings you must implement if you create your own installation program (as opposed to localizing an existing Netscape installer).

Note that in the Netscape installers, these settings are implemented only within .INI files. This simplifies modifying and localizing the installer. It is recommended that your installer do the same.

You may observe the registry changes made by any product with tools such as Regmon. This may be a useful addition to your toolset.

These notes are applicable to Netscape Communicator version 4.03.
MPLAY32.INI

Key : HKEY_LOCAL_MACHINE\Software\Netscape
Name : (Default)
Value:
Type :

Key : HKEY_LOCAL_MACHINE\Software\Netscape\Media Player
Name : CurrentVersion
Value: 4.03 (en)
Type :

Key : HKEY_LOCAL_MACHINE\Software\Netscape\Media Player\4.03 (en)
Name : (Default)
Value:
Type :

Key : HKEY_LOCAL_MACHINE\Software\Netscape\Media Player\4.03 (en)\Main
Name : Install Directory
Value: [Default Path]\MPlayer
Type : REGDB_STRING

Name : Program Folder
Value: [Program Folder]
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\.LAM
Name : (Default)
Value: LAMDocument
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\LAMDocument\shell\open\command
Name : (Default)
Value: [WINSYSDIR]\mplay32.exe %1
Type : REGDB_STRING

Name : (Default)
Value: [WINDIR]\mplayer.exe %1
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\LAMDocument\DefaultIcon
Name : (Default)
Value: [Default Path]\MPlayer\npcfg32.exe ,0
Type : REGDB_STRING

Key : H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\MCI32
Name : LiveAudioFile
Value: mcilma32.dll
Type : REGDB_STRING

Key : H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\MCI
Name : LiveAudioFile
Value: mcilma.dll
Type : REGDB_STRING

Key : H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\MCI32
Name : LiveAudioMetafile
Value: mcilau32.dll
Type : REGDB_STRING

Key : H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\drivers.desc
Name : mcilau32.dll
Value: (MCI) Netscape Media Player
Type : REGDB_STRING

Key : H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\MCI
Name : LiveAudioMetafile
Value: mcilau.dll
Type : REGDB_STRING

Key : H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\MCI Extensions
Name : LAM
Value: LiveAudioMetafile
Type : REGDB_STRING

Name : LMA
Value: LiveAudioFile
Type : REGDB_STRING

Name : LA
Value: LiveAudioFile
Type : REGDB_STRING

Key : H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\drivers.desc
Name : mcilma32.dll
Value: (MCI) Netscape Packetized Audio
Type : REGDB_STRING

Key : H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\Drivers32
Name : MSACM.NSPAC
Value: NSPAC32.ACM
Type : REGDB_STRING

Key : H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\drivers.desc
Name : NSPAC32.ACM
Value: elemedia(TM) AX24000P Music Codec
Type : REGDB_STRING

Key : H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\Drivers32
Name : MSACM.voxacm118
Value: vdk32118.acm
Type : REGDB_STRING

Key : H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\drivers.desc
Name : vdk32118.acm
Value: Voxware 32bit Codec
Type : REGDB_STRING

Key : H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\Drivers32
Name : MSACM.NSX83
Value: NSX83P32.ACM
Type : REGDB_STRING

Key : H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\drivers.desc
Name : NSX83P32.ACM
Value: elemedia(TM) SX8300 Speech Codec
Type : REGDB_STRING

Key : H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\Drivers32
Name : MSACM.NSMLAW
Value: NSMLAW32.DLL
Type : REGDB_STRING

Key : H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\drivers.desc
Name : NSMLAW32.DLL
Value: Netscape G.711 Decoder
Type : REGDB_STRING



NAV40.INI

Key : HKEY_LOCAL_MACHINE\Software\Microsoft\Windows\CurrentVersion\App Paths\Netscape.exe
Name : (Default)
Value: [Default Path]\Program\Netscape.exe
Type : REGDB_STRING

Name : Path
Value: [Default Path]\Program
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\CLSID\{7865A9A1-33A8-11d0-BED9-00A02468FAB6}\InprocServer32
Name : (Default)
Value: [Default Path]\Program\brpref32.dll
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\CLSID\{543EC0D0-6AB7-11d0-BF56-00A02468FAB6}\InprocServer32
Name : (Default)
Value: [Default Path]\Program\brpref32.dll
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\CLSID\{543EC0D1-6AB7-11d0-BF56-00A02468FAB6}\InprocServer32
Name : (Default)
Value: [Default Path]\Program\brpref32.dll
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\CLSID\{2D0A7D70-748C-11d0-9705-00805F8AA8B8}\InprocServer32
Name : (Default)
Value: [Default Path]\Program\edpref32.dll
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\CLSID\{E8D6B4F0-8B58-11d0-9B63-00805F8ADDDE}\InprocServer32
Name : (Default)
Value: [Default Path]\Program\mnpref32.dll
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\CLSID\{DDF4AB60-8B84-11d0-9B63-00805F8ADDDE}\InprocServer32
Name : (Default)
Value: [Default Path]\Program\mnpref32.dll
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\CLSID\{CC3E2871-43CA-11d0-B6D8-00805F8ADDDE}\InprocServer32
Name : (Default)
Value: [Default Path]\Program\mnpref32.dll
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\CLSID\{CC3E2872-43CA-11d0-B6D8-00805F8ADDDE}\InprocServer32
Name : (Default)
Value: [Default Path]\Program\mnpref32.dll
Type : REGDB_STRING

Key : HKEY_LOCAL_MACHINE\Software\Netscape
Name : (Default)
Value:
Type :

Key : HKEY_LOCAL_MACHINE\Software\Netscape\Netscape Navigator
Name : CurrentVersion
Value: 4.03 (en)
Type :

Key : HKEY_LOCAL_MACHINE\Software\Netscape\Netscape Navigator\Users
Name : (Default)
Value:
Type :

Key : HKEY_LOCAL_MACHINE\Software\Netscape\Netscape Navigator\4.03 (en)
Name : (Default)
Value:
Type :

Key : HKEY_LOCAL_MACHINE\Software\Netscape\Netscape Navigator\4.03 (en)\Main
Name : Install Directory
Value: [Default Path]
Type : REGDB_STRING

Name : Java Directory
Value: [Default Path]\Program\Java
Type : REGDB_STRING

Name : NetHelp Directory
Value: [Default Path]\Program\NetHelp
Type : REGDB_STRING

Name : Plugins Directory
Value: [Default Path]\Program\Plugins
Type : REGDB_STRING

Name : Program Folder
Value: [Program Folder]
Type : REGDB_STRING

Key : HKEY_CURRENT_USER\Software\Netscape
Name : (Default)
Value:
Type :

Key : HKEY_CURRENT_USER\Software\Netscape\Netscape Navigator
Name : (Default)
Value:
Type :

Key : HKEY_CURRENT_USER\Software\Netscape\Netscape Navigator\Main
Name : Install Directory
Value: [Default Path]
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\NetscapeMarkup\CLSID
Name : (Default)
Value: {61D8DE20-CA9A-11CE-9EA5-0080C82BE3B6}
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\NetscapeMarkup\Insertable
Name : (Default)
Value:
Type :

Key : HKEY_CLASSES_ROOT\NetscapeMarkup\protocol\StdFileEditing\server
Name : (Default)
Value: [Default Path]\Program\Netscape.exe
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\NetscapeMarkup\protocol\StdFileEditing\verb\0
Name : (Default)
Value: &Edit
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\NetscapeMarkup\shell\open\command
Name : (Default)
Value: [Default Path]\Program\Netscape.exe "%1"
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\NetscapeMarkup\shell\print\command
Name : (Default)
Value: [Default Path]\Program\Netscape.exe /print("%1")
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\NetscapeMarkup\shell\print\ddeexec
Name : (Default)
Value: [print("%1")]
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\NetscapeMarkup\shell\PrintTo\command
Name : (Default)
Value: [Default Path]\Program\Netscape.exe /printto("%1","%2","%3","%4")
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\NetscapeMarkup\shell\PrintTo\ddeexec
Name : (Default)
Value: [("%1","%2","%3","%4")]
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\NetscapeMarkup\shell\open\ddeexec
Name : (Default)
Value: "%1"
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\NetscapeMarkup\shell\open\ddeexec\Application
Name : (Default)
Value: NSShell
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\NetscapeMarkup\shell\open\ddeexec\Topic
Name : (Default)
Value: WWW_OpenURL
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\NetscapeMarkup\shell\Edit\command
Name : (Default)
Value: [Default Path]\Program\Netscape.exe -edit "%1"
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\NetscapeMarkup\shell\Edit\ddeexec
Name : (Default)
Value: [edit("%1")]
Type : REGDB_STRING

Key : HKEY_LOCAL_MACHINE\Software\Netscape\Netcaster
Name : CurrentVersion
Value: 4.03 (en)
Type : REGDB_STRING

Key : HKEY_LOCAL_MACHINE\Software\Netscape\Netcaster\4.03 (en)\Main
Name : Install Directory
Value: [Shell Path]\Netcast
Type : REGDB_STRING

Name : Program Folder
Value: [Program Folder]
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\CLSID\{C98D0190-7D81-11d0-BF8D-00A02468FAB6}\InprocServer32
Name : (Default)
Value: [Default Path]\Program\brpref32.dll
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\CLSID\{37B601C0-8AC8-11d0-83AF-00805F8A274D}\InprocServer32
Name : (Default)
Value: [Default Path]\Program\brpref32.dll
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\CLSID\{913A4A20-8EBF-11d0-BFAB-00A02468FAB6}\InprocServer32
Name : (Default)
Value: [Default Path]\Program\brpref32.dll
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\NetscapeMarkup\shell\print\ddeexec\Application
Name : (Default)
Value: NSShell
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\NetscapeMarkup\shell\PrintTo\ddeexec\Application
Name : (Default)
Value: NSShell
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\NetscapeMarkup\shell\Edit\ddeexec\Application
Name : (Default)
Value: NSShell
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\NetscapeMarkup
Name : (Default)
Value: Hypertext Markup Language
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\telnet
Name : (Default)
Value: URL:Telnet Protocol
Type : REGDB_STRING

Key : HKEY_CLASSES_ROOT\telnet\shell\open\command
Name : (Default)
Value: telnet %1
Type : REGDB_STRING



NETCAST.INI

Key : HKEY_LOCAL_MACHINE\Software\Netscape
Name : (Default)
Value:
Type :

Key : HKEY_LOCAL_MACHINE\Software\Netscape\Netcaster
Name : CurrentVersion
Value: 1.0 (en)
Type : REGDB_STRING

Key : HKEY_LOCAL_MACHINE\Software\Netscape\Netcaster\1.0 (en)
Name : (Default)
Value:
Type :

Key : HKEY_LOCAL_MACHINE\Software\Netscape\Netcaster\1.0 (en)\Main
Name : Install Directory
Value: [Default Path]
Type : REGDB_STRING

Name : Program Folder
Value: [Program Folder]
Type : REGDB_STRING



NSCONF.INI

Key : HKEY_LOCAL_MACHINE\Software\Netscape
Name : (Default)
Value:
Type :

Key : HKEY_LOCAL_MACHINE\Software\Netscape\Conference
Name : (Default)
Value:
Type :

Key : HKEY_LOCAL_MACHINE\Software\Netscape\Conference\CurrentVersion
Name : Description
Value: Conference
Type : REGDB_STRING

Name : InstallDate
Value: [TIME]
Type : REGDB_NUMBER

Name : Installed
Value: 1
Type : REGDB_NUMBER

Name : PathName
Value: [Default Path]
Type : REGDB_STRING

Name : SoftwareType
Value: application
Type : REGDB_STRING

Name : VersionBuild
Value: 1213
Type : REGDB_NUMBER

Name : VersionMajor
Value: 1
Type : REGDB_NUMBER

Name : VersionMinor
Value: 0
Type : REGDB_NUMBER

Key : H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\Drivers32
Name : MSACM.VOXACM118
Value: vdk32118.acm
Type : REGDB_STRING

Name : MSACM.NSX83
Value: nsx83p32.acm
Type : REGDB_STRING

Name : MSACM.NSX723
Value: sx5363s.acm
Type : REGDB_STRING

Name : MSACM.NSMLAW
Value: nsmlaw32.dll
Type : REGDB_STRING

Key : HKEY_CURRENT_USER\Software\Netscape
Name : (Default)
Value:
Type :

Key : HKEY_CLASSES_ROOT\nscfile\shell\open\command
Name : (Default)
Value: [Default Path]\NSConf32.exe -f "%1"
Type : REGDB_STRING

Key : HKEY_LOCAL_MACHINE\Software\Netscape\Conference
Name : CurrentVersion
Value: 4.03 (en)
Type : REGDB_STRING

Key : HKEY_LOCAL_MACHINE\Software\Netscape\Conference\4.03 (en)
Name : (Default)
Value:
Type :

Key : HKEY_LOCAL_MACHINE\Software\Netscape\Conference\4.03 (en)\Main
Name : Install Directory
Value: [Default Path]
Type : REGDB_STRING

Name : Program Folder
Value: [Program Folder]
Type : REGDB_STRING


[BACK]
[CONTENTS]
1998, Copyright Netscape Communications Corp. All Rights Reserved